If you're:

1. Strange like me and collect your budgies feathers

2. Looking for something to do with the collected feathers

then perhaps you could try something like this. It used up most of the Blinkie feathers i've been collecting since Blinkie's first moult. :D

I made it with 2 bits of thick art paper (one for the feathers to be taped to and the other to make the back look neat), lots of feathes, lots of tape and a head shot of Blinkie. I taped the feathers in rows because after trying a few methods on little bits of paper i found that tape did the least damage to the feathers and left them looking smooth and beautiful. Glue made them go all scruffy and it was too messy.
